Litigation Attorney salary in Canada

Average Yearly Salary of Litigation Attorney in Canada is approximately 106,129 CAD (106,568 USD). Data is for 2025 and indicates a pre-tax value. The salary itself depends on multiple factors such as seniority, job performance, certifications, experience or any other bonuses. The value indicated is an average amount based on records we have in database. Real values may vary. The data is for orientational purposes.

What does Litigation Attorney do?

occupation personasA litigation attorney is a legal professional who specializes in representing clients in civil lawsuits. They are responsible for handling all aspects of the litigation process, from conducting initial case assessments to drafting legal documents, negotiating settlements, and representing clients in court. Litigation attorneys work on a wide range of cases, including personal injury claims, contract disputes, employment law matters, and more. Their primary role is to advocate for their clients' interests and ensure that their legal rights are protected. They conduct extensive research, gather evidence, interview witnesses, and develop strategies to present a strong case in court. Litigation attorneys also engage in settlement negotiations, aiming to resolve disputes outside of court when possible.

Salary increase per years of experience

Based on data available the salary increase per years of experience is as following

    0 years (beginner) equals base salary
    1 to 5 years of experience yields up arrow+12% salary increase
    6 to 10 years of experience yields up arrow+25% salary increase
    11 to 15 years of experience yields up arrow+16% salary increase
    16 to 25 years of experience yields up arrow+9% salary increase
    more than 25 years of experience yields up arrow+10% salary increase
NOTE: Details based on limited set of data. Percentages may vary. The salary increase over years of experience can vary widely based on factors such as job industry, job role, location, company size, and individual performance.
